Werder Bremen vs Freiburg

Freiburg’s faltering bid to land a Bundesliga top-four finish takes them to the Weserstadion to take on Werder Bremen.

Werder Bremen pulled off an epic upset last weekend, squeaking past perennial champions Bayern Munich 1-0 in their backyard to make it five Bundesliga matches unbeaten (W2, D3) after back-to-back losses by 2+ goals ‘to nil’ beforehand. However, there’s no room for complacency as Ole Werner’s men have failed to win three times in their last four home league games (D2, L1), barring a 2-0 triumph against bottom-half Augsburg in early December. Moreover, they’ve gone winless in three consecutive top-flight H2Hs on home turf (D2, L1) since a 2-1 victory in April 2019, conceding precisely two goals on two occasions. Flying out of the traps is imperative for Werder, considering their dismal 73% loss ratio in Bundesliga games in which they’ve fallen behind in 2023/24 (W1, D2, L8).

On the other hand, Freiburg kicked things off in 2024 with a dull 0-0 home draw against a downtrodden Union Berlin side but bounced back with a goal-glutted 3-2 win against TSG Hoffenheim last weekend. The visitors’ hopes of capturing a long-overdue top-four finish hang by a thread, as they languish five points adrift fourth-placed RB Leipzig at the start of this round. Playing on the road is unlikely to alleviate pressure on manager Christian Streich, knowing his men have only won 33% of their away league matches this season (W3, D1, L5). But ‘Breisgau-Brasilianer’ have reigned supreme in this match-up, outscoring Werder in their last three top-flight H2Hs, including a narrow 1-0 triumph in the reverse fixture in August 2023.
